Following these 4 steps can help you to Futureproof your site for Google Algorithm updates:
1. Publishing Quality Unique content
2. Publishing consistently
3. Fast website (Ensure that your website loads fast. Try to lower Time to Interactive as much as possible)
4. Start building off-page SEO. More people & press talking about you and linking to you, the better.

iZooto182 views2055 days agoAs the Native Advertising ecosystem continues to evolve, capturing your user's attention at the right moment remains the key for any advertising campaign to be successful. Native advertising has enabled publishers to run paid ads that match the look, feel, and function of the media format in which they appear. Publishers can now run highly relevant content ads on their pages which do not stick out like a sore thumb. Native Advertising guarantees an almost 'non disruptive' user experience, which is great. Publishers who run ads are usually extra careful to not annoy the users with intruding Ads, this is where native Ads come to their rescue.
